Hey Priya — handing over the cron drift investigation on Bellhop before I'm out. Short version: the scheduler on the Marrowgate boxes drifts about 40s/day because NTP sync was silently disabled after the base image refresh; jobs with tight windows (mostly the ledger snapshots) were firing late and occasionally overlapping. I've re-enabled sync on two hosts as a test and drift flattened out. Nothing malicious, but worth your sign-off since the snapshot job touches audit data. Current settings on the affected hosts are below.

config for hahip-kaguf:
[holath]
port = 8443
region = north-4
host = holath.tolvaqlabs.internal
timeout_ms = 1000
retries = 2

## Authentication

Context for the sync: user module is now split out of the Harrowgate monolith as a standalone service, Wrenfold. Monolith calls Wrenfold over internal mesh; external callers never hit it directly. Auth: static service key per caller, validated at the gateway, rotated monthly. Session logic stays in the monolith for now — token minting moves next quarter. Migration flag is on in staging only. For staging smoke tests, authenticate with the key below.

service key, fawip-bajef: kto11_Qt5wZK9vdNC

Ticket: SHARD-1107 — Expired credentials blocking profile-store resharding

The resharding job for the Mosswood user-profile store halted at shard 14 of 32 when its credential for the internal SplitPlane API expired mid-run. The job is idempotent, so resuming is safe once auth is restored. Future maintainers: check credential expiry before kicking off multi-day reshards; the run planner does not warn you. The reissued key is below.

gateway credential: kto3_qfe

## Releases

Scrubshot strips EXIF from every uploaded image before publish. Release builds run the scrub test suite against the golden corpus; a single leaked GPS tag fails the build. Tag the release, push, wait for CI green, then publish. All release artifacts must be signed before upload, using the key below.

deploy key for kajof-fajop: bky6_gDHw9Q